Is there a way to tell what the currently playing video is in a video wallpaper that's pulling a random video from a folder? Or is there a log of the videos saved somewhere? I have it all basically working, except once in a while a blank screen appears, and I'm assuing there's one video in the folder that isn't compatible with the codecs installed. IDing that one video would be useful so I can troubleshoot. thanks!
